One of the primary benefits of genetic testing is the ability to identify potential health risks and take preventative measures to mitigate them By analyzing an individual’s DNA, genetic testing can provide information on a wide range of health conditions, including heart disease, cancer, and genetic disorders Armed with this knowledge, individuals can work with their healthcare providers to develop personalized treatment plans and make informed decisions about their health.
Genetic testing can also be a useful tool for individuals who are trying to conceive By testing for genetic mutations that may be passed on to offspring, couples can assess their risk of having a child with a genetic disorder This information can help couples make decisions about family planning and seek out appropriate medical interventions, such as in vitro fertilization with preimplantation genetic diagnosis.
In addition to health-related benefits, genetic testing can also provide insights into an individual’s ancestry and genetic background Many genetic testing companies offer ancestry reports that can trace an individual’s genetic roots back to specific regions around the world This information can be particularly meaningful for individuals who are interested in genealogy and want to learn more about their family history.
Despite the many benefits of genetic testing, there are also limitations and ethical considerations to be aware of One of the main limitations of genetic testing is the accuracy of the results While advances in technology have greatly improved the accuracy of genetic testing, there is still a margin of error to consider In some cases, genetic testing results may be inconclusive or misinterpreted, leading to unnecessary anxiety or medical interventions.

For example, there are concerns about the privacy and security of genetic data Many individuals are hesitant to undergo genetic testing out of fear that their genetic information could be misused or shared without their consent In the UK, strict regulations are in place to protect the privacy of genetic data and ensure that individuals have control over how their information is used.
Another ethical consideration is the potential for genetic discrimination In some cases, individuals who undergo genetic testing and receive unfavorable results may face discrimination in areas such as employment or insurance coverage To combat this issue, laws have been put in place to prevent genetic discrimination and ensure that individuals are not unfairly penalized based on their genetic information.
